What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in FDA job openings, and why are they important?

To thrive in FDA job openings, candidates typically need a strong background in science, regulatory affairs, and analytical skills, often with a relevant degree in biology, chemistry, pharmacy, or related fields. Familiarity with regulatory databases, submission systems (such as eCTD), and certifications like RAC (Regulatory Affairs Certification) are highly valued. Attention to detail, effective communication, and the ability to work collaboratively are essential soft skills for success. These competencies ensure regulatory compliance, thorough review of submissions, and effective teamwork in safeguarding public health.

What are some common challenges faced by professionals starting in FDA roles, and how can applicants prepare for them?

Professionals beginning their careers at the FDA often encounter challenges such as adapting to complex regulatory frameworks, working with cross-disciplinary teams, and managing the pace of policy changes. To prepare, applicants should familiarize themselves with FDA guidelines and regulatory processes, develop strong communication skills to collaborate effectively with scientists, regulators, and industry representatives, and stay updated on current public health issues. Proactive learning and seeking mentorship within the organization can also ease the transition and foster professional growth.

What are FDA openings?

FDA openings refer to job opportunities or vacancies at the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A). The FDA is a federal agency responsible for protecting public health by regulating food, drugs, medical devices, and other related products. These openings span a wide range of roles, including scientists, inspectors, analysts, administrative professionals, and more. Candidates can find current job listings and application instructions on the official USAJOBS website and the FDA’s careers page. Working at the FDA offers the chance to contribute to public health and safety at a national level.

About the role:


As Associate Director Statistical Programming you will be responsible for representing Statistics in all assigned cross-functional clinical study teams and other projects and holding accountability for all statistical aspects, as well as for providing statistical input into clinical development plans, clinical study protocols, clinical study reports, regulatory submission documents, and publications ensuring accurate deliverables.


Your main responsibilities are:

  • Work as part of a collaborative, cross-functional team with members from other discipline
  • Perform and/or verify sample size calculations
  • Lead development of statistical analysis plans and TLFs, perform statistical analyses and validate analysis results
  • Participate in planning for health authority meetings, development of associated documents, and the preparation of associated responses
  • Oversee outsourced statistical CRO activities and deliverables ensuring highest quality and in a timely manner
  • Support and participate in the development of departmental strategies
  • Provide guidance to Statistical Programmers on SDTM/ADaM and TLFs specifications development and programming
  • Provide input to database requirements and work closely with Clinical Data Manager to ensure data quality standards are met


What you have to offer:

  • PhD or Masters in (Bio)Statistics, Mathematics or equivalent
  • Minimum 5 years (8 years for masters) in the pharmaceutical industry and/or CRO
  • At least 3 years of work/leadership experience, overseeing statistics staff (internal as well as outsourced) and in representing Biostatistics in a matrix organization and in a multidisciplinary team
  • Experiences in planning, conducting and analyses of oncology or infectious diseases trials from phase I-IV, including scientific publications
  • Experience in answering health authority questions (FDA, EMA) and in leadings statistics on regulatory submissions, including developing ISE/ISS packages
  • Good knowledge and experience of clinical development, study designs, advanced statistical methods (adaptive design and/or Bayesian is a Plus), regulatory guidelines (ICH, FDA, EMA)
  • Good knowledge of statistical analysis software (SAS or R) and sample size calculation software (e.g., EAST and/or NQuery)
  • Very good understanding of special topics like Diagnostics, Biomarker, PK/PD, PRO, RWE, is a plus
  • Very Good analytical skills and bility to analyze complex issues to develop relevant and realistic plans, programs, recommendations, risk mitigation strategies, and the ability to communicate them to cross functional colleagues
  • Strong drive for achieving high quality working results in a timely manner, while always safeguarding ethical standards in work and behaviors
  • Very good communication skills:
    • the ability to express complex analysis in clear language
    • an excellent command of English written spoken
